The Max Planck Sciences Po Center on Coping with Instability in Market Societies (MaxPo) is welcoming applications from senior academics for research stays of approximately two months at Sciences Po in the heart of Paris.
Established in 2012 by the Max Planck Society and Sciences Po Paris, MaxPo is a FrancoGerman center in the social sciences. Its research focuses on investigating how individuals, organizations, and polities are coping with the increased instability that has developed in Western societies during the last forty years due to liberalization policies and cultural shifts. Research at the center is led by two co-directors, Olivier Godechot and Cornelia Woll.
MaxPo’s research agenda can be found at maxpo.eu/research. We encourage researchers with projects in economic and financial sociology, political economy, economic history, and political history to apply.
